ompXMembrane protein; OmpX; involved in cell adhesion; forms an eight-stranded antiparallel beta-barrel that protrudes from the cell surface; mutations in the gene increase cell-surface contact in fimbriated strains but decrease contact in nonfimbriated strains; Derived by automated computational analysis using gene prediction method: Protein Homology. (171 aa)
